Trauma-Informed Series | Session 4
Traditional discipline systems often prioritize punishment and compliance over understanding, regulation, and restoration. This professional learning experience helps educators examine the long-term impact of zero-tolerance practices while exploring trauma-informed approaches that strengthen accountability, emotional safety, and student support.
Participants will reflect on how discipline practices influence student relationships, engagement, and access to learning while gaining practical strategies that reduce exclusionary responses and strengthen supportive classroom systems.

Through collaborative discussion, reflection, and real-world application, educators will explore how to maintain high expectations while responding to student behavior in ways that are consistent, relationship-centered, and instructionally supportive.
Participants Will Explore:
The impact of zero-tolerance practices on students and school culture
The connection between behavior, regulation, and emotional safety
Trauma-informed approaches to discipline and student support
Strategies for reducing power struggles and reactive responses
Relationship-centered practices that maintain accountability
Supportive classroom systems that strengthen student engagement and consistency
Reflective practices that help educators examine discipline responses and decision-making
